Output 58df568beb3907a3619e4c3f88f684aa3f0537664d89e86087a045a49d7ab209:1

value
1168989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ed85c697b7f2fcb5f86bb6cade5bdcf6563bc5b OP_EQUAL
address
37RK1TkPpBnxEsDqBmG8u3UtmrkCdBmvLw
transaction
58df568beb3907a3619e4c3f88f684aa3f0537664d89e86087a045a49d7ab209
confirmations
315255
spent
true